Robust association tests under different genetic models, allowing for binary or quantitative traits and covariates
So, HC; Sham, PC - 2011
The association of genetic variants with outcomes is usually assessed under an additive model, for example by the trend test. However, misspecification of the genetic model will lead to a reduction in power. More robust tests for association might therefore be preferred. A useful approach is to...
